As for Baker definitely playing at the next level, I am very confident he'll be in camp with some team, but actually winning and holding onto a starting job is very difficult. Kickers often play into their forties meaning job openings are small. Teams also value the experience in a special teams player. Breeding was a very good punter for us recently too and he didn't make a roster. This season, Baker had arguably one of the best seasons for a punter we've ever had; however, it wasn't ridiculously better than some other punting seasons (Breeding and the aussie guy, his name escapes me right now). However, Baker has the best chance we've seen in a while. Just noting that there's a fair amount of luck in making it as a special teams kicker.
